Asamiya Park

Asamiya Park, Urban park in Kasugai City, Japan.

Description

Asamiya Park is a public park in Kasugai featuring sports facilities, tennis courts, baseball fields, and an athletic field called Spore Kasugai. The grounds span about 12.5 hectares and provide space for different sporting activities.

History

The park transferred to Kasugai City management from Aichi Prefecture on April 1, 2017. This administrative change marked a new chapter in how the location was overseen.

Culture

A Japanese garden by the main entrance displays cherry blossoms during spring and draws many visitors. This seasonal sight shapes the experience for people who come to the park at that time of year.

Practical

The park offers 249 parking spaces and sits three minutes from Takayama Stop via Meitetsu bus service from Katsugawa Station. Visitors should note this bus connection for convenient access.

Did you know?

The Arakitsu Canal runs along the western edge and the Hattagawa River flows along the eastern side of the grounds. These two waterways shape the natural setting of the park distinctly.
